Parc historique de la Pointe-du-Moulin
2500, boulevard Don-Quichotte - Notre-Dame-de-L'Île-Perrot, Québec J7V 7P2
This incomparable regional treasure will transport you over 300 years ago to the days of New France. Come and meet characters from the past who will make you discover the traditional life of the seigneurial regime or take a moment to enjoy the park's exceptional view of the Saint-Louis Lake and the Saint-Laurent River. Rich in history, the Parc historique de la Pointe-du-Moulin has one of the only two functioning windmills out of 18 in Quebec. Archery, paddle boats rental and picnicking are just some of the many outdoor activities to be enjoyed on this legendary site. It is also possible to reserve the site for your receptions, wedding or other special events.
